- Black pipe and galvanized pipe are made of steel
- Galvanized pipe has a zinc coating, black pipe does not
- Galvanized pipe is ideal for carrying water but not suitable for carrying gas
- Galvanized pipe is more expensive because of zinc coating
- Galvanized pipe is more durable

Carbon steel is susceptible to corrosion. Blackening is a process to create a tenacious oxide coating that provides some corrosion resistance. Black steel is made of steel that has not been galvanized. Its name comes from the scaly, dark-colored iron oxide coating on its surface.

While the two materials are very similar, carbon steel actually contains less carbon and more iron. Carbon steel is composed of roughly 99 percent iron to 1 percent carbon, while cast iron normally contains 2 to 3 percent carbon to 97 to 98 percent iron.

Carbon steel pipe is used for liquid, gas, and steam services both above- and belowground services. It is not recommended for use in corrosive services but may be used in caustic services.

Black steel pipe is not really a specification, but a generic term used primarily by plumbers to distinguish between regular steel pipe and galvanized steel pipe.

Municipal chilled water lines 4 inches and larger in diameter typically use cast iron pipes and fittings. Unless the pipe is heavy, commercial die-casting is not suitable for lines subject to expansion strain, contraction, and vibration. It is not suitable for superheated steam or temperatures above 575 degrees Fahrenheit. Cast iron pipe in underground applications (such as sewers) usually has bell and socket ends, while exposed pipe usually has flanged ends.

Why are seamless tubes used in bicycle frames?
These types of pipes were ideal for bicycle frames because they have thin walls, are lightweight but strong. In 1895, the first plant to produce seamless tubes was built. As bicycle manufacturing gave way to auto manufacturing, seamless tubes were still needed for gasoline and oil lines.

How does X-ray gauge work?
For instance, X-ray gauges are used to regulate the steel’s thickness. The gauges work by utilizing two X-rays. One ray is directed at a steel of known thickness while the other at the passing steel on the production line. If there is any variance between the two rays, the gauge will automatically trigger a resizing of the rollers to compensate. Pipes are also inspected for defects at the end of the process. One method of testing a pipe is by using a special machine that fills the pipe with water and then increases the pressure to see if it holds.
